What the Nevada Emissions Test Actually Checks

Nevada emissions testing measures the exhaust output from your vehicle’s engine to verify it meets state pollution standards. Clark County requires it for most registration renewals. The test happens on-site at the hut — your vehicle stays running, the tech performs the test, and the whole process is over in minutes for most standard vehicles.

When your vehicle passes, the result is submitted directly to the Nevada DMV. You do not need to carry a certificate to a DMV office or mail anything in. The DMV record updates automatically, and you can complete your registration renewal right here if it is also due.

How the Result Connects to Your DMV Registration

When your vehicle passes, the result is submitted electronically to the Nevada DMV by the testing station. You do not carry a paper certificate to a DMV office. The Nevada DMV’s system receives the passing result, and your registration renewal can proceed. For most Clark County vehicles, this electronic submission is the required step that unlocks the renewal. You do not need to do anything else with the test result — the submission happens automatically when your vehicle passes.

What If the Vehicle Fails

If your vehicle fails, you leave with the test result documentation. The documentation records what your vehicle’s exhaust system produced during the test, which gives a smog repair technician or 2G-certified location the information they need to diagnose the next step. The emissions test result itself is not a repair diagnosis — it is a measured outcome. A 2G-certified smog shop interprets what it means for the specific vehicle. 1G Station — What That Means for You

This hut is a 1G station, which covers standard Nevada emissions testing for qualifying gasoline-powered vehicles. Diesel testing is not available here. Smog-related repair and diagnostics are also not performed on-site. If your vehicle is diesel, call (702) 436-5346 before you drive out.
